DescriptionThe AWS Email Marketing Team is looking for an exceptional Software Development Engineer to join our team. Are you passionate about building highly scalable systems and tackling big data challenges? If so, then join us!The AWS Email Marketing Team is building its own world-class user personalization and campaign management platform that will drive the customer experience and the overall impact of communications delivered through the AWS email channel. The team provides AWS global marketing stakeholders with tools, governance, and the operations support to effectively deliver programs that drive AWS growth and adoption. This means you will have a direct impact on the success of AWS in attracting, nurturing, and delighting our customers.We are looking for a Software Development Engineer (SDE) who has delivered distributed systems on AWS infrastructure. You will be responsible for system design, development, code reviews, peer mentoring, release processes, and system monitoring. The Software Development Engineer partners with other engineers, product managers, and data science teams to develop new data-driven capabilities delivering process automation and performance optimization.
